About the role

You know how to elevate every guest experience, one service at a time.

As Food & Beverage Outlet Manager, you will lead the day-to-day operations of the hotel’s food and beverage outlets, including the Dining Room, Room Service, Lounge, Terrace and Banquets, while contributing to their growth, visibility and overall guest experience.

This role is ideal for someone who enjoys being close to the floor, supporting teams through service and creating memorable hospitality moments, while also contributing to revenue, profitability, positioning and continuous improvement.

Working closely with the Managing Partner, General Manager and key partners across the hotel and head office, you will help bring ideas to life, support business priorities and ensure each outlet delivers an experience that reflects Germain Hotels’ standards.

 

WHAT YOU’LL DO

  • Lead the daily operations of all assigned food and beverage outlets, ensuring smooth execution, consistent service standards and memorable guest experiences.
  • Recruit, onboard, coach and develop team members while fostering a culture of accountability, collaboration and genuine hospitality.
  • Remain visible on the floor during service, supporting the team, engaging with guests and resolving concerns with professionalism, care and sound judgment.
  • Manage staffing levels, scheduling, labour productivity, payroll, gratuities, inventory, equipment and operating supplies while identifying opportunities to improve efficiency and control costs.
  • Work closely with the culinary team to ensure strong coordination between kitchen and front of house.
  • Collaborate with the Managing Partner and General Manager on business strategies that support the positioning, performance and profitability of each outlet.
  • Analyze financial results, guest feedback, market trends and competitive activity to identify opportunities for growth, improvement and innovation.
  • Develop and implement action plans to achieve revenue, profitability, labour, productivity, satisfaction and loyalty targets.
  • Participate in annual business planning, budgeting, forecasting, departmental meetings, BEO meetings, leadership meetings and planning sessions.
  • Contribute ideas for menu evolution, seasonal programming, pricing strategies, promotional events, collaborations, product launches and signature experiences.
  • Work with Marketing, Public Relations, Digital and Social Media teams on campaigns, activations and storytelling that increase awareness and drive traffic.
  • Ensure all guest-facing experiences are aligned with the hotel’s positioning and Germain Hotels’ brand standards.
  • Work closely with Revenue Management, Sales, Catering, Housekeeping and Front Office to maximize hotel-wide opportunities.

 

WHAT YOU’LL BRING

  • 4 to 5 years of progressive leadership experience in restaurants, hotels or upscale hospitality environments.
  • A strong passion for hospitality and a genuine desire to create memorable guest experiences.
  • Proven ability to lead, coach and mobilize teams while remaining actively involved in daily operations.
  • Strong business sense, with the ability to understand financial results and translate them into concrete action plans.
  • Experience collaborating on marketing, communications, events or brand initiatives is considered an asset.
  • Excellent organizational, communication and coaching skills.
  • A proactive and entrepreneurial mindset, with the ability to identify opportunities, solve problems and bring new ideas forward.
  • Knowledge of food safety standards, labour legislation and licensing regulations.
  • The ability to balance planning, guest experience, team leadership and hands-on execution in a fast-paced environment.
